Science or Fiction Each week our host will come up with three science news items or facts, two genuine, one fictitious. He will challenge our panel of skeptics to sniff out the fake – and you can play along. Item 1: A new study finds that when Europeans move to more walkable cities, they walk more, but the same is not true for Americans, who do not change their total average walking. Item 2: Researchers report the first clinical tests of an mRNA based treatment that demonstrates protection against all viruses. Item 3: Researchers find that the retina synchronizes the signals from different receptors before they get to the optic nerve to minimize temporal distortion. Segment #6.
